Understanding Chronic Pain

Before we delve into the benefits of yoga for chronic pain, it's essential to understand the nature of this condition. Chronic pain differs from acute pain in that it persists for extended periods, often lasting more than three months.

Chronic pain can arise from various underlying conditions, including:

  • Arthritis
  • Fibromyalgia
  • Back pain
  • Neck pain
  • Chronic fatigue

How Yoga Alleviates Chronic Pain

Yoga, an ancient mind-body practice, offers a multifaceted approach to chronic pain management. Here's how it works:

Pain Reduction: Yoga poses engage specific muscles and joints, promoting relaxation and reducing muscle tension. This helps alleviate pain by reducing inflammation and improving blood circulation.

Improved Mobility: Gentle yoga movements enhance flexibility and range of motion, making it easier to perform daily activities. Increased mobility allows you to move more, which further reduces pain and promotes overall well-being.

Stress Reduction: Chronic pain can take a significant toll on mental health. Yoga incorporates mindfulness and deep breathing techniques that help calm the nervous system and reduce stress levels. This relaxation response can help alleviate pain perception.

Empowerment: Yoga empowers individuals with chronic pain by teaching them techniques they can use to manage their condition. It fosters a sense of control and self-reliance, reducing the reliance on medication and other external interventions.

Getting Started with Your Yoga Journey

Embarking on a yoga journey for chronic pain requires patience and consistency. Here are some tips:

  • Start Gradually: Begin with short sessions and gradually increase the duration and intensity as you progress.
  • Listen to Your Body: Modify poses or rest when needed. Avoid pushing through pain or discomfort.
  • Find a Qualified Instructor: Consider working with a certified yoga instructor who specializes in chronic pain management for guidance and support.
  • Be Patient: Results may take time, so be consistent with your practice and don't get discouraged.
  • Enjoy the Journey: Yoga is not just about physical benefits; it's a holistic approach to well-being. Embrace the mindfulness and relaxation aspects of the practice.
